Germany calls for payment system independent of US

The Minister for Foreign Affairs of Germany believes that Europe is too dependent on the US. Heiko Maas came to this conclusion after the US refused to make concessions to Iran and unilaterally withdrew from the previously signed nuclear agreement. In addition, Donald Trump threatened sanctions for those who continued to deal with an authoritarian regime.

The US ignored Germany’s opinion that the withdrawal from the agreement was a mistake, and it became the reason for the Foreign Ministry's statement. "In this situation, it is of strategic significance that we say clearly to Washington: we want to work together, but we will not allow you to act over our heads to our detriment," Maas said. To solve the situation he called for strengthening of European autonomy through creation of independent payment channels. Guided by the fact that it is better to keep peaceful relations, Germany, among other things, promotes its own commercial interests. The current agreement "is better than the potentially explosive crisis that threatens the Middle East otherwise," Maas added.

However, even having the European Monetary Fund and an independent SWIFT payment system, Europe understands that it is impossible to compete with the US even with such an arsenal. According to Maas, Europe is trying to take the positions that are left by the United States. The Minister said, that it is not possible to close all the gaps, but together the European countries can mitigate the most serious consequences of thinking, which considers success in the amount of dollars saved.

So the parting of these two allies is unlikely, in this case it is just contentious issues between partners.
